2013-03-03 2 views
2

У меня проблема, и я не понимаю, что вызывает это. Я купил классный шрифт для использования в отзывчивом дизайне. При определенных размерах окна шрифт обрезается краем окна. Вот скриншот:
enter image description hereWebfont отключается при определенных размерах окна

Использование CSS3 word-break как-то решает это, но я не хочу использовать его в этом случае. Есть ли другие варианты?
Я бы предпочел только вариант CSS, но если задействованы JavaScript или jQuery, я бы тоже был в порядке.

Используемый шрифт - Armitage Black Italic from MyFonts. Вот мой CSS для этого текста:

.text { 
    font-weight: normal; 
    margin-bottom: 24px; 
    color: blue; 
    font-family: ArmitageBlack-Italic, sans-serif; 
    font-size: 3.75em; 
    line-height: .85; 
    text-transform: uppercase; 
    letter-spacing: -0.29ex; 
} 

Проблема может быть воссозданы с любым шрифтом, пока он достаточно велик. Если шрифт выделен курсивом, это действительно очевидно.
Текст внутри этого контейнера:

.container { 
    display: table; 
    width: 100%; 
    height: 100%; 
    padding-top: 25px; 
    background-color: grey; 
    text-align: center; 
} 
+0

На самом деле, очень сложно помочь, не зная ни одного вашего CSS-кода, вашего веб-сайта или ссылки на демонстрационную страницу – Ryan

+0

@minitech Извините за это! Я добавил информацию о шрифтах и ​​CSS. Мне бы хотелось создать тестовую страницу, но поскольку это шрифт, который вы должны купить, это будет невозможно. Я боюсь. – Sven

+0

Внутри любой контейнер с установленной шириной или правило 'word-wrap', или ...? Также может ли он быть воспроизведен с помощью любого из ваших местных шрифтов? Arial Black курсив или что-то еще? – Ryan

ответ

1

Учитывая, что текст написан курсивом, текст будет отображаться за пределами того, где он «есть» - и с большим шрифтом, проблема еще хуже. Единственный способ исправить это - это взломать добавку, насколько мне известно :(

+0

Ну, спасибо, в любом случае! – Sven

Смежные вопросы